The Mexico mushroom market size reached USD 1.1 Billion in 2025. The analyst expects the market to reach USD 1.9 Billion by 2034, exhibiting a growth rate (CAGR) of 5.78% during 2026-2034. The increasing consumer awareness of medicinal mushrooms' health benefits, a growing preference for organic and sustainable farming practices, and the rising demand for mushroom-based food products due to the shift toward plant-based diets and alternative proteins, enhancing the Mexico mushroom market growth and diversification.

MEXICO MUSHROOM MARKET TRENDS:

Growing Demand for Medicinal Mushrooms:

In Mexico, the market for medicinal mushrooms such as Reishi, Shiitake, and Cordyceps is expanding very fast as the population becomes more aware of their health benefits. The mushrooms are highly prized due to their immune-stimulating, anti-inflammatory, and antioxidant activities, which appeal to the health-conscious community. As the focus on wellness continues to grow, individuals are increasingly opting for functional foods that provide benefits beyond basic nutrition, leading to a shift in dietary habits. This increasing demand for health-promoting ingredients has propelled the increase in medicinal mushroom production. Local producers and foreign companies alike are scaling up their production to cater to the increasing demand for these mushrooms, presenting substantial opportunities in the Mexican mushroom industry. With ongoing consumer demand for natural health remedies, the market will continue to grow in the next few years impacting a positive Mexico mushroom market outlook.

Shift Toward Organic and Sustainable Farming Practices:

In regions like Atlacomulco, Valle de Bravo, and Zitácuaro in the State of Mexico, the cultivation of 5,000 tons of mushrooms annually is powered by sustainable farming practices. By using agricultural by-products like barley straw and coffee pulp, approximately 407,871 kg of these materials are converted into 34,626 kg of edible mushrooms. This eco-friendly process generates 228,888 kg of spent substrate, which is transformed into organic fertilizer, enriching the soil for future crops. Mexican shoppers, more mindful of environmental consequence and health issues, are also giving preference to organic and pesticide-free foods. Consequently, organically grown mushrooms, which have no synthetic chemicals, are also gaining popularity. Mushroom farmers in response are moving towards sustainable production practices, such as biodegradable packaging materials, organic culture, and efficient energy use practices, so the demand for organically grown and clean-label mushroom products is kept up while maintaining the environmental sustainability of mushroom culture.

Expansion of Mushroom-Based Food Products:

The development of mushroom-based food items is a main trend in the Mexican mushroom industry, fueled by increased demand for plant-based eating and alternative proteins. Mushrooms are being used more and more as diverse ingredients across an array of food products, such as meat substitutes, snacks, soups, and sauces. Their capacity to increase the nutritional content and palatability of foods makes them a desirable option for consumers in search of healthier, plant-based options. As consumers demand such products increase, processed mushroom foods such as mushroom powders, extracts, and capsules become increasingly available, widening the Mexico mushroom market share. The products appeal to consumers with various tastes, including those in the wellness industry, who are in search of functional, nutrient-rich foods. This change toward mushroom-based alternatives is revolutionizing the food environment, an outgrowth of more general movements toward sustainability and healthy eating.
